Sister States and Regions
- Iowa, USA (since 1960)
- Minas Gerais, Brazil (since 1973)
- Sichuan Province, China (since 1985)
- Chungcheongbuk-do, Korea (since 1992)
- SaƓne-et-Loire, France (since 2000)
- Fairfield, California, USA (since 1970s)
